The shelter in town somehow got in a cockatiel that has no history. I don't know a thing about her past or even how old she is. She was apparently found living outside. She's definitely tamed, and steps up for me most of the time. She's an AMAZING flyer. She will take off fly around the room and land on my finger. I have named her "chessie" and she is currently in quarantine. I bought a new cage that will eventually house her and my boy, Jazz pending approval from them of course. She likes to scrap her beak under our fingernails, gross, but cute. If she gets ahold of my girlfriends nails she will chew right through em. She makes beautiful little sounds, and seems to enjoy being talked to.
She's a Pearl I think? I have read that most likely she's a female as most male Pearls return to normal grey after maturing. Any insight into that? I went ahead and ordered a DNA test anyways. I've always been wooed by their beautiful mutations.
